A steel duct penetrates a wall assembly composed of studs and gypsum board up to a maximum size of 100 inches by 100 inches. The annular space around the duct is packed with mineral wool, batt insulation, or fiberglass packing material. Firestop sealant is applied to a five-eighths inch depth on both sides of the assembly against steel angles. The penetration achieves a one and two-hour F-rating and a one-half hour T-rating.
